Is 2619 Mission Apartments Safe?

Somewhat — crime here is near the national average. 2619 Mission Apartments in San Francisco, CA has a safety grade of C+. The overall crime index is 156, which is 56% above the national average of 100.

Compared to the San Francisco average (crime index 104), 2619 Mission Apartments is 52%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.

Looking at specific crime types, vehicle theft is the most elevated concern (index: 171, 71%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 62).
